- verbrepositioning (present participle)
- place in a different position; adjust or alter the position of:"try repositioning the thermostat in another room"
- change the image of (a company, product, etc.) to target a new or wider market:"our assignment was to reposition coffee from a “rite of passage” drink to a “contemporary experience.”"

- Repositioning is the process of changing the way that people think about a product, service, or company12. It involves revising the marketing strategy for a product or service so as to increase sales3. Repositioning can change a target market's understanding or perception of a product or service's features and how they compare to competing products2.Learn more:✕This summary was generated using AI based on multiple online sources.
